A
  • Autopilot:
    The robot build that is used for the STEM Lab. This robot is built during the first hands-on activity within the STEM Lab and is used to complete the rest of the STEM Lab activities.
B
  • Behavior:
    The building blocks of robotics programming. A behavior is a way that a robot acts, and can range from basic to complex, depending on how the robot is built or programmed.
D
  • Drivetrain:
    A rectangular structure with two motors, four wheels and gears that transmit power from the motors to all wheels.
S
  • Speed:
    The rate at which something is able to move or operate.
V
  • Velocity:
    The speed of something in a given direction.
  • VEXcode IQ Blocks:
    A block-based programming language used to program a VEX IQ robot.
